.bp-cb-steps{padding:40px 0 0}.bp-cb-hero{padding:56px 0 96px}.bp-cb-hero-inner{max-width:640px;margin:0 auto;text-align:center}.bp-cb-icon{display:inline-flex;align-items:center;justify-content:center;width:64px;height:64px;border-radius:50%;background:rgba(35,161,91,0.10);color:#1e7d4b;margin:0 auto 24px;position:relative}.bp-cb-icon::before,.bp-cb-icon::after{content:"";position:absolute;inset:0;border-radius:50%;border:2px solid rgba(35,161,91,0.35);animation:bp-cb-ring 2.4s cubic-bezier(0.22,0.61,0.36,1) infinite;pointer-events:none}.bp-cb-icon::after{animation-delay:1.2s}@media (prefers-reduced-motion:reduce){.bp-cb-icon::before,.bp-cb-icon::after{animation:none;opacity:0}}.bp-cb-title{margin:0 0 16px;letter-spacing:-0.025em}.bp-cb-sub{color:var(--kb-color-text-subtle);margin:0 auto 32px;max-width:520px}.bp-cb-cta{display:inline-flex;gap:12px;flex-wrap:wrap;justify-content:center}.bp-cb-while{margin:14px auto 0;font-size:var(--kb-text-xs);color:var(--kb-color-text-faint)}.bp-cb-next{padding:80px 0;background:var(--kb-color-page-frame)}.bp-cb-next-head{margin-bottom:48px;text-align:center;max-width:560px;margin-inline:auto}.bp-cb-next-head .t-eyebrow{display:block;margin-bottom:8px}.bp-cb-next-h{margin:0}.bp-cb-timeline{list-style:none;margin:0 auto;padding:0;max-width:640px;position:relative}.bp-cb-tl-item{position:relative;display:grid;grid-template-columns:32px 1fr;gap:24px;padding-bottom:48px}.bp-cb-tl-item:last-child{padding-bottom:0}.bp-cb-tl-marker{position:relative;display:flex;justify-content:center}.bp-cb-tl-dot{width:14px;height:14px;border-radius:50%;background:var(--kb-color-card-bg);border:2px solid var(--kb-color-brand);margin-top:8px;box-shadow:0 0 0 4px rgba(255,138,20,0.12);z-index:1}.bp-cb-tl-item:not(:last-child) .bp-cb-tl-marker::after{content:"";position:absolute;top:26px;bottom:-32px;left:50%;width:2px;margin-left:-1px;background:var(--kb-color-border-soft);border-radius:1px}.bp-cb-tl-meta{display:flex;align-items:baseline;gap:12px;margin-bottom:6px}.bp-cb-tl-step{font-size:var(--kb-text-xs);text-transform:uppercase;letter-spacing:0.06em;font-weight:600;color:var(--kb-color-brand)}.bp-cb-tl-when{font-size:var(--kb-text-xs);color:var(--kb-color-text-subtle);font-weight:500}.bp-cb-tl-h{margin:0 0 6px;letter-spacing:-0.01em}.bp-cb-tl-p{margin:0;color:var(--kb-color-text-subtle)}.bp-cb-direct{padding:80px 0 96px}.bp-cb-direct-card{display:flex;align-items:center;justify-content:space-between;gap:32px;padding:28px 32px;background:var(--kb-color-card-bg);border:1px solid var(--kb-color-card-border);border-radius:14px;flex-wrap:wrap;transition:border-color 0.18s ease,box-shadow 0.18s ease}.bp-cb-direct-card:hover{border-color:var(--kb-color-text-subtle);box-shadow:0 4px 12px rgba(20,24,30,0.04)}.bp-cb-direct-text h3{margin:0 0 4px}.bp-cb-direct-text p{margin:0;color:var(--kb-color-text-subtle)}.bp-cb-direct-lines{display:flex;gap:24px;flex-wrap:wrap}.bp-cb-direct-line{display:inline-flex;align-items:center;gap:8px;color:var(--kb-color-text);text-decoration:none;font-weight:500;transition:color 0.15s ease}.bp-cb-direct-line:hover{color:var(--kb-color-brand)}.bp-cb-direct-line:hover svg{color:var(--kb-color-brand)}.bp-cb-direct-line svg{color:var(--kb-color-text-subtle);transition:color 0.15s ease}